Manager, Logistics Data and BI

MSCCN - Saint Louis, MO

Apply Now

Job Description

Job Description Weu2019re seeking a Manager to lead logistics data migration and business intelligence initiatives that move data from legacy platforms into modern cloud data ecosystems and improve visibility across the supply chain. This role sits at the intersection of data engineering, analytics, and logistics operations, owning the backlog for migration and reporting workstreams and ensuring highu2011quality, onu2011time delivery. The successful candidate brings handsu2011on experience with complex data migration, strong fluency in modern data platforms (including Databricks), and the ability to translate logistics business needs into clear technical requirements and priorities. They are a disciplined product owner who can partner with crossu2011functional stakeholders, manage competing priorities, and drive continuous improvement in data quality and delivery processes.
